No inventories were on hand at July 1, the beginning of the quarter. No raw material was on hand at September 30. All units on hand at September 30 were fully complete as to processing. Following is a summary of costs and other data for the period ended September 30:
Products Alpha Beta Gamma
Units sold 28,00082,60098,000
Units on hand at September 3070,000056,000
Sales revenues $ 126,000 $ 743,400 $ 1,029,000
Departments 123
Raw material cost $ 470,400 $ 0 $ 0
Direct labor cost 201,600339,780805,350
Manufacturing overhead 84,00088,620307,650
Required:
Determine the following amounts for each product: (1) estimated net realizable value used for allocating joint costs, (2) joint costs allocated to each of the three products, (3) cost of goods sold, and (4) finished goods inventory costs, September 30.
Assume that the entire output of Alpha could be processed further at an additional cost of $12 per unit and then sold for $16.30 per unit. Compute the incremental income (loss) from further processing Alpha.
Considering the results of part b, should Lipton Liquids process Alpha further?
